首页 / 高防服务器 / 正文
揭秘页面自动转跳功能,从技术实现到应用场景解析,页面自动转跳紧急拿笔

Time:2025年03月15日 Read:11 评论:42 作者:y21dr45

本文目录导读:

揭秘页面自动转跳功能,从技术实现到应用场景解析,页面自动转跳紧急拿笔

  1. 页面自动转跳的背景
  2. 技术实现:从JavaScript到页面跳转
  3. 应用场景:页面自动转跳的实际应用
  4. 技术优化:提升页面自动转跳的效率
  5. 案例分析:页面自动转跳的实际应用

在网页开发中,页面自动转跳功能是一种非常实用的技术,能够提升用户体验,尤其是在处理紧急情况或用户异常操作时,尽管这种方法在实际应用中非常常见,但许多人对其背后的技术细节了解不足,本文将深入探讨页面自动转跳功能的技术实现、应用场景以及最佳实践,帮助开发者更好地理解和应用这一功能。

页面自动转跳的背景

页面自动转跳是指在用户执行特定操作(如点击按钮、输入特定内容或发生时间触发)时,页面会自动跳转到另一个页面的行为,这种功能通常通过JavaScript脚本实现,可以在不同场景下发挥重要作用,在紧急情况下,页面自动转跳可以快速引导用户完成操作,避免危险情况升级。

技术实现:从JavaScript到页面跳转

要实现页面自动转跳,开发者需要掌握JavaScript的基本操作,尤其是如何控制页面导航,以下是实现页面自动转跳的关键步骤:

使用window.location控制导航

页面自动转跳的核心在于控制window.location对象,该对象用于管理页面导航,通过调用window.location的方法,开发者可以将焦点从当前页面跳转到目标页面。

a. 使用window.location.href绑定点击事件

最常见的方式是通过window.location.href绑定点击事件,当用户点击一个按钮时,JavaScript脚本可以将window.location.href设置为目标页面的URL。

b. 使用window.location.navigate绑定输入事件

除了点击事件,开发者还可以使用window.location.navigate方法绑定输入事件,这使得用户可以在页面上输入特定内容时,页面自动跳转到目标页面。

c. 使用window.location redirect绑定时间触发事件

在某些情况下,开发者可能希望页面在特定时间(如页面加载后5秒)自动跳转,可以通过window.location.redirect方法实现这一点。

处理跳转中的常见问题

在实现页面自动转跳时,开发者可能会遇到一些常见问题,例如超时、页面加载失败、安全漏洞等。

a. 跳转超时的处理

为了避免用户因页面跳转超时而失去焦点,开发者需要设置合理的超时时间,并在超时后手动跳转页面。

b. 验证目标页面的安全性

在跳转到外部页面时,开发者需要确保目标页面的安全性,避免用户在点击广告或弹窗后被引导到恶意网站。

c. 处理页面加载异常

在某些情况下,页面加载可能会失败,导致跳转功能失效,开发者需要添加错误处理代码,确保页面在加载失败时仍能正常显示。

应用场景:页面自动转跳的实际应用

页面自动转跳功能在实际应用中有着广泛的应用场景,以下是几种典型的应用案例:

紧急情况导航

在医疗系统中,页面自动转跳可以用于快速引导患者完成紧急操作,当患者按下紧急按钮时,页面会自动跳转到医生咨询页面,帮助用户获得及时帮助。

用户异常操作处理

在在线客服系统中,页面自动转跳可以用于处理用户的异常操作,当用户输入错误的用户名或密码时,页面会自动跳转到注册页面,引导用户重新登录。

购物车操作优化

在电子商务系统中,页面自动转跳可以用于优化购物车操作,当用户点击“购买”按钮时,页面会自动跳转到结算页面,减少用户操作的复杂性。

网站导航优化

在复杂网站中,页面自动转跳可以用于简化导航流程,当用户输入特定关键词时,页面会自动跳转到相关内容页面,提升用户体验。

技术优化:提升页面自动转跳的效率

尽管页面自动转跳功能非常实用,但在实际应用中,开发者仍需注意一些优化点,以提升页面性能和用户体验。

合理布局,减少跳转次数

在页面设计中,合理布局可以减少用户需要执行的跳转操作,可以将常用功能集中在一个页面,减少用户切换页面的次数。

使用缓存技术

通过缓存技术,开发者可以减少页面跳转时的性能消耗,可以在缓存层中存储页面内容,避免频繁的页面加载操作。

合理注释代码

在编写页面自动转跳功能时,合理注释代码可以帮助其他开发者理解代码逻辑,提升维护效率。

案例分析:页面自动转跳的实际应用

以一个常见的在线购物系统为例,页面自动转跳功能可以显著提升用户体验,当用户在浏览商品时,点击“购买”按钮后,页面会自动跳转到结算页面,在此过程中,开发者通过JavaScript脚本实现了页面导航,确保用户操作流畅,同时避免了页面加载失败的风险。

页面自动转跳功能是网页开发中非常实用的技术,能够提升用户体验,尤其是在处理紧急情况或用户异常操作时,通过掌握JavaScript的基本操作和合理设计页面布局,开发者可以轻松实现页面自动转跳功能,需要注意处理跳转中的常见问题,确保页面导航的安全性和稳定性,随着技术的发展,页面自动转跳功能还可以与其他技术结合,如人工智能和大数据分析,进一步提升用户体验。

排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1